Meeting notes, excerpt — Brundell site receiving. Discussed the replacement lock assembly for the records safe in Room 12. The unit ships tomorrow from Vastrom Security Works in a sealed crate; only the facilities lead may sign. The old mechanism stays installed until the fitter arrives Thursday. Receiving must photograph the crate seals before acceptance and file the images with the works order. At hand-over, the courier must be told the following phrase.

handover note for yagef-bagep: the drudor pelius courier leaves the kasdor zorvan norir ledger at gate 8016 under passcode 755406

## Further Reading

Deep-link routing in the Wrenfall mobile app touches several trust boundaries: URL scheme registration, universal-link validation, and the intent dispatcher on Android builds. Reviewers should pay particular attention to how unvalidated path segments reach the navigation layer, and to the allowlist governing external app handoffs. Known bypass patterns from past audits are catalogued separately. Threat model, routing tables, and prior review notes are consolidated on the internal page linked below.

wiki page, tahaf-tajog: https://jira.ordindyn.corp/pipeline

Lintwright is the documentation linter that runs against every docs repo at Marbelline. It operates in three environments: dev (branch pushes), staging (merge queue), and prod (the nightly full-corpus sweep). Each environment pins its own rule bundle version, so a rule promoted in dev will not affect prod until the bundle is bumped. Maintainers should never edit rules directly in prod; promote through staging first. Secrets are injected at deploy time and are not stored in the repo. The per-environment settings are as follows.

settings of fafog-haduf:
ZORIX_PIN=4648
ZORIX_METRICS_HOST=metrics.zorix.paliqsys.corp
ZORIX_LOG_LEVEL=info
ZORIX_TENANT=druix

Subject: Crash pipeline onboarding note. Welcome to the Fernhollow release channel. Quick orientation: crash reports from the Lumen mobile app flow through the ingest gateway, get symbolicated, then land in the triage board within about five minutes. If symbolication lags, check the dSYM uploader job first — it fails quietly when a build ships without symbols. New builds must be registered before rollout or their crashes group incorrectly. Register each build using the identifier below.

pipeline stamp: htk31_f769b577b3028a4e9958e5bb8d1259a